This historic country house hotel welcomes dogs with open arms, providing a warm, dog-friendly atmosphere. It offers dog-friendly dining in the Drawing Room or Bar, and is situated near dog-friendly attractions like the Cliveden Estate and Burnham Beeches. The hotel provides food and water bowls.

Dog Friendly HotelSummary of reviews related to the 'Dog Friendly' categoryNestled in the picturesque village of Streatley in Berkshire, The Swan stands out as a haven for dog lovers and their furry companions. This hotel is frequently praised for its extremely dog-friendly environment, extending warm hospitality to both guests and their pets. Accommodations for dogs are thoughtfully designed with many rooms on the ground floor offering easy garden access, creating ample space for pets to roam freely.
Amenities for dogs are robust, featuring well-equipped rooms that include dog beds, bowls and even treats, ensuring that canine guests have a comfortable stay. The hotel goes the extra mile by providing a dog welcome pack, adding a personal touch to their great dog hospitality.
While most reviews emphasize the positive aspects, such as the beautiful and accommodating environment for dogs and the fact that dogs are allowed in almost all areas, there are occasional mentions of areas needing better cleaning after pet stays. Nonetheless, the general ambiance remains super dog-friendly, making The Swan in Streatley a top choice for pet owners looking to enjoy a relaxing and inclusive getaway. Show more

Summary of reviews related to the 'Dog Friendly' categoryThe Christopher Hotel in Eton stands out as a remarkably dog-friendly establishment, earning high praise from guests for its accommodating nature towards pets. The staff consistently receive accolades for their friendliness and helpfulness, ensuring that both guests and their furry companions feel welcome. The hotel provides high-quality amenities specifically for dogs, including beds and bowls. Guests appreciated the thoughtful touches, such as complimentary sausages for dogs at breakfast and a dedicated dog welcome pack.
The rooms are considered ideal for travelers with dogs, offering a serene environment that is both clean and quiet at night. The hotel’s pet-friendly policies are underscored by the attention and care shown to each dog, making them feel as special as their human counterparts. Access to an easily reached field at the rear of the hotel allows for convenient early morning walks, enhancing the overall experience for pet owners.
Overall, the Christopher Hotel’s commitment to being a dog-friendly venue is evident through its excellent facilities, attentive staff and welcoming atmosphere, making it a perfect choice for guests traveling with their canine friends. Show more

Dog Friendly InnSummary of reviews related to the 'Dog Friendly' categoryThe Dundas Arms is highly regarded for its dog-friendly atmosphere, making it an ideal choice for travelers with pets. Guests appreciate the accommodating staff and pet-friendly facilities that extend throughout the pub and rooms. Many note the convenience of being able to bring dogs into the restaurant, which enhances the overall experience. The hotel also offers a dog-friendly canal-side room with a patio, providing an excellent setting for both pets and their owners. Moreover, the location is praised for offering delightful walks along the canal, perfect for morning strolls with canine companions. This welcoming atmosphere ensures that both guests and their dogs feel right at home. Show more
